Herman Cain Announces 2012 Presidential Exploratory Committee

And the 2012 race begins properly.

Fellow patriots, now more than ever, we must come together to take a stand for the future of America. I make this promise to you as I deliberate the ways in which I can do my part to restore and protect the American Dream: I would be the voice of the American People. I will keep you in my thoughts and prayers. I ask you to do the same for me.

Cain, a former turnaround expert in the restaurant industry, ran for U.S. Senate in Georgia seven years ago, losing the GOP primary but performing well for a first-time candidate. Prior to that he’d written a series of books on leadership; since that he’s become a popular conservative pundit, with his popularity surging since the rise of the Tea Party.
